Lake Lucerne is a beautiful and captivating lake in Central Switzerland, the fourth largest in the country. It is known for its picturesque views, with its steep shores rising into mountains up to 1,500 meters above the lake. The lake's complicated shape includes several sharp bends and four arms - Urnersee, Gersauer Becken, Buochser Bucht, and Vitznauer Bucht — joined in the center by a narrow opening between the Unter Nas and Ober Nas of the Bürgenstock Mountain. Visitors can explore the area around Lake Lucerne through boat rides stopping at charming towns and villages on the shoreline, and circular train tours passing through Arth-Goldau.
